The prayer sought for in this writ petition is for a Writ of Mandamus directing the 4th respondent to take appropriate action on the representation of the petitioners dated 21.07.2022 in pursuance to the 1st respondent's letter dated 03.08.2022 in Oo.Mu.22239/2022/J1.
2. In respect of property at S.No.39/4A-4C in patta No.433 which according to the petitioners is the property belongs to the petitioners' family, however patta has been wrongly issued in the name of one B.R.Vadivel and therefore, in order to cancel the same and to issue proper joint patta in respect of the said property including the names of the petitioners, the petitioners had given representation to the respondents 2 to 4.
3. In this regard the 1st respondent/District Collector, having received the representation given by the petitioners, has sent communication on 03.08.2022 to the 4th respondent to look into the matter and to pass necessary orders to that effect on the application of the petitioners. 2/6
4. Despite these communications, since the application submitted by the petitioners for rectification has not so far been considered by the 4th respondent/Tahsildar, the petitioners have filed the present writ petition.
5. Heard Mr.T.Panchatsaram, learned counsel appearing for the petitioners who having reiterated the aforesaid would seek indulgence of this Court.

Heard Mrs.Akila Rajendran, learned Government Advocate appearing for the respondents who on instruction would submit that as per the directive issued by the District Collector dated 03.08.2022, the application of the petitioner would be considered and decided on merits and in accordance with law by the 4th respondent/Tahsildar within a time frame that may be stipulated by this Court.
7. Considering the said submissions made by the learned counsel for both sides and taking into account the limited scope of the prayer sought for in this writ petition, this Court is inclined to dispose of this writ petition with the following orders:

That there shall be a direction to the 4th respondent/ Tahsildar to pass orders on the petitioners representation dated 21.07.2022 of course in pursuance with the direction given by the 1st respondent/District Collector dated 03.08.2022 after giving opportunity of being heard to both the petitioner as well as the third party in whose name the patta now stands as stated by the petitioners and pass orders thereon within a period of six we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
